The First Wife's Taleby Jane Biran

The First Wife's Tale is an intriguing family fiction novel that chronicles the home and work life, secrets and drama of northern Labour politician Robert Bennett providing insight into life as a politician's wife.

Jane Biran's latest novel trails Robert's wife Isabel as she realises her husband's London life might not be as quiet and uncomplicated as she had first assumed. Robert has two secrets, only one of which he has shared with his wife. He confided in his wife that he suffers from OCD but fails to share with his beloved Isabel that he is hiding a mistress down in London. The possibly fatal illness of the Opposition Leader presents Robert with the chance to fulfil his life-long career dream, but to do so he realises he may have to call time on his extramarital activity. Isabel's life is far from simple, even without the added complications caused by her other half. She is a marriage guidance counsellor and a social activist, as well as a homemaker and main support for their two children: a teenage daughter and a younger son who has Down's Syndrome. The First Wife's Tale is complex, engrossing and far-reaching in its universal themes: from politics to marriage, careers to children, balancing work and life, and caring for a child with disabilities. This contemporary fiction novel describes the up, downs and complexities of a family that is stretched to breaking point. Food, cooking, eating and family meal times are intrinsic to the story; visualising and realising them was incredibly important to Jane, so she created a selection of the recipes featured in the book and has added them to the book's appendix.

 

About the Author

[image]

Jane Biran was born in London but was evacuated as an infant to northeast Lancashire. She was educated at a local grammar school before studying at Liverpool University and then London School of Economics. Jane has enjoyed a number of different careers; a trainee fashion buyer, in public relations, journalism and as a professional fundraiser for international charities.

She has three children from her first marriage and currently divides her time between London and Jerusalem with her second husband, Israel's former Ambassador to the Court of St. James's. Since retiring, Jane has concentrated on writing fiction while continuing to work in a voluntary capacity for a number of cultural institutions. Other novels written by Jane Biran include Hope Street and The Guest of Honour.
